Best Wakefield Public Preschools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 637 students in the neighborhood of Wakefield, Tucson, AZ.
The top-ranked public preschool in Wakefield is Hollinger K-8 School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Wakefield, Tucson, AZ public preschool have an average math proficiency score of 20% (versus the Arizona public pre school average of 36%), and reading proficiency score of 22% (versus the 40%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Arizona public preschool average of 67% (majority Hispanic).
